A native of Union County, North Carolina
also preceded in death by her daughter: Mrs. Allie Burgess Barnes .
She was widely known in the building industry in Waycross . They moved to Waycross 22 years ago from Atlanta, Ga. and was a faithful member of the First Presbyterian Church .
Minnie is survived by her husband: George William Burgess and a granddaughter Miss Helen Barnes both of Waycross ..
Funeral services will be held Tuesday afternoon at 6 o'clock at the First Presbyterian Church with Rev. A.G. McInnis , pastor of the church following burial next to her daughter in Lott cemetery ..
W.L. Hinson and Company Funeral Home
